How can doing the right thing hurt so much?? i am an animal lover. No doubt about that. My grandmaw loved animals. my aunt loves animals. i love animals. on our way out of town yesterday, my aunt and i came across a kitten, it was limping pretty badly, it's tail and hind legs had horrible gashes, basically, and i lack any nicer way to put this, the cat was rotting away. the smell alone was awful. but being the kind people we are, we couldn't let it wander around suffering. so despite how dirty this poor creature was, we picked her (as we found out) up and brought her to our vet. My aunt explained that she has 8 cats, most of which are rescues from times before and that se would pay up to $800 for treatment (as money was tight for her) the vet proceded to check the cat out and then explained that the most humane thing to do was to put her down. It's sad that we had to be the ones to experience this tragedy. the owners took no responsibility and let this poor cat roam around until it died. I am so upset, but at the same time i know that cat is pain free now. The poor baby won't suffer any more. i just felt that i needed to stress how important it is to watch for stray animals. i have such a weak spot for animals, which is how we eded up with 5 dogs. 3 of which are rescue shelties. |
